In the year 2012, with album #6 in the chamber, Everytime I Die blasts away at the music world with a self-consciously dark and angry addition to their characteristic sound. Ex Lives is a more immediately memorable and accessible than their previous effort, New Junk Aesthetic, and yet retains the same bitterness while reminding the listener of the attitude of Gutter Phenomenon. In a way, Everytime I Die has accomplished exactly what they needed to: retain the original spirit and fury of the metalcore explosion of 2004/05 without sounding stale or redundant. (more…)
